Their literature review will then be a summary of the fieldwork methodologies … WebBelow we’ve prepared a step-by-step guide on how to write a systematic literature review. 1. Decide on your team. When carrying out a systematic literature review, you should employ multiple reviewers in order to minimize bias and strengthen analysis. A minimum of two is a good rule of thumb, with a third to serve as a tiebreaker if needed.
